Trustees chair McCartan re-elected

<Page 1 of 1>

Cleveland lawyer Patrick McCartan '56, '59J.D. was re-elected chair of the Board of Trustees, extending his tenure to 2007.

He has been a trustee since 1989 and was elected board chair and a fellow of the University in 2000.

McCartan is senior partner of the international law firm Jones Day and has been cited in surveys by The National Law Journal as one of the country's most respected and influential lawyers.
